About College of Coastal Georgia

The College of Coastal Georgia (Coastal Georgia) is a public college in Brunswick, Georgia, United States. It was established in 1961 and opened in 1964, making it one of Georgia's newest state colleges. The college transitioned from a community college into a four-year college and conferred its first baccalaureate degrees on May 7, 2011.

College of Coastal Georgia FAQ

Is College of Coastal Georgia a public or private school?

College of Coastal Georgia is a public institution located in Brunswick, GA.

What is the acceptance rate at College of Coastal Georgia?

College of Coastal Georgia has an acceptance rate of 98%, based on the latest U.S. Department of Education data.

How much does College of Coastal Georgia cost?

The average annual net price at College of Coastal Georgia is $15,261 — the typical cost after grants and scholarships for federally-aided students. Published tuition is $3,616 in-state and $10,936 out-of-state.

What is the graduation rate at College of Coastal Georgia?

About 26% of students at College of Coastal Georgia complete their degree, according to federal completion data.

How much do College of Coastal Georgia graduates earn?

Ten years after enrolling, College of Coastal Georgia students earn a median of $39,318 per year.

What SAT or ACT scores do you need for College of Coastal Georgia?

Admitted students at College of Coastal Georgia have an average SAT score of 1,000 and an ACT midpoint of 19. Requirements vary, so check the school's admissions office for the latest.

How many students attend College of Coastal Georgia?

College of Coastal Georgia enrolls about 2,979 students.
